IntelliJ Can't Save GitLab Token: GNOME Keyring Locked

IntelliJ was failing to save my GitLab API token. Every time I tried to add or update my GitLab account in Settings, the operation would silently fail or timeout. The IntelliJ logs showed repeated warnings: WARN - #c.i.c.RemoteCredentialStore - Timeout while waiting for credentials Root Cause On Fedora (and other Linux distributions with GNOME), IntelliJ stores credentials in the system’s native keyring via the freedesktop.org Secret Service API. The GNOME Keyring was locked, preventing any credential storage. ...

Preventing Your Dual-Homed Linux Box from Bridging Networks

If you’re running a homelab with multiple network segments, there’s a good chance you have at least one machine connected to more than one network. Maybe your workstation has a wired connection to your DMZ and wireless to your trusted WLAN. Convenient? Yes. A potential security hole? Also yes. The Problem My workstation sits on two networks: wireless connected to my home WLAN (192.168.3.0/24) and wired into my DMZ (192.168.4.0/24). The DMZ is intentionally isolated—it’s where I run services exposed to the internet. The WLAN is where everything else lives: personal devices, management interfaces, the stuff I actually care about protecting. ...
